What Does a Data Scientist Do?



Data science is mainly about using data to understand problems and support better decisions.



A data scientist may collect and clean data, identify patterns, build statistical models and create reports or visualisations. They often work with businesses to answer questions such as:


Why are sales falling?


Which customers are most likely to leave?




What products are performing best?


How can costs be reduced?


Data scientists commonly use tools and languages such as Python, SQL, Excel, Power BI, R and statistical techniques.


If you enjoy analysing information, finding patterns and turning numbers into business insights, data science could be a strong career choice.


What Does an AI Professional Do?



AI focuses more on building systems that can learn, predict, generate content or automate tasks.



AI professionals may work with machine learning, natural language processing, computer vision, generative AI and other technologies.


For example, an AI system might predict equipment failures, recommend products, understand customer messages or generate text and images.



AI roles can involve programming, mathematics, machine learning frameworks and cloud platforms. Depending on the role, you may work with technologies such as Python, machine learning libraries, Azure, AWS or other AI platforms.



If you enjoy technology, experimentation and building intelligent systems, AI may be more suitable for you.


AI and Data Science Overlap


The two fields are closely connected.



Data is the foundation of many AI systems, while data scientists increasingly use machine learning and AI tools in their work.



For example, a data scientist might analyse customer data and build a predictive model. An AI engineer might then take a machine learning model and develop it into a production system that can serve thousands of users.



This overlap means that learning one field can make it easier to move into the other later.



Which One Is Easier to Start With?



For beginners, data analytics and data science can sometimes provide a more gradual entry into the technology field.


You can begin with Excel, SQL, Power BI and basic statistics before progressing towards Python, machine learning and advanced analytics.


AI can also be approached from a beginner level, particularly through generative AI and AI productivity tools. However, more technical AI engineering roles generally require stronger programming and mathematical foundations.



You don't necessarily need to become an advanced programmer immediately. Start with the skills required for the specific role you want.

Which Career Has Better Opportunities?


There isn't one universal winner.



AI is attracting significant attention because organisations are adopting generative AI, automation and machine learning across industries. At the same time, companies continue to need professionals who can understand data and turn it into useful business decisions.


Rather than choosing a career simply because it is trending, look at the skills employers are requesting in the roles you want.


Search current job descriptions and identify recurring requirements. This will give you a much clearer idea of what to learn.


You Can Combine Both Skills


One of the strongest approaches may be to develop skills across both areas.



For example, you could start with SQL, Excel, Power BI and data analysis, then learn Python and statistics before moving into machine learning and AI.



This combination can make you valuable in roles where businesses need someone who understands both the data and the technology built around it.
